This entertaining and erudite social history now in its fourth paperback edition tells the remarkable story of America's transformation from a nation of honest appetites into an obedient market for instant mashed potatoes. In \"Perfection Salad\", Laura Shapiro investigates a band of passionate but ladylike reformers at the turn of the twentieth century - including Fannie Farmer of the Boston Cooking School - who were determined to modernize the American diet through a 'scientific' approach to cooking. Shapiro's fascinating tale shows why we think the way we do about food today.","brand":"University of California Press","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":54220416876888,"sku":"9780520257382","price":31.99,"currency_code":"EUR","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0278\/1295\/4195\/files\/9780520257382_27723438-b8aa-4b51-b041-faf45cd08042.jpg?v=1771312550","url":"https:\/\/agendabookshop.com\/products\/perfection-salad","provider":"Agenda Bookshop","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
